dpkt解析pcapng格式包
在dpkt文档里没有找到解析pcapng格式的部分,以为dpkt不能解析pcapng格式的包。后面看到一份源码发现可以使用dpkt.pcapng.Reader()来读取pcapng格式。但是如果数据集中pcap格式的包和pcapng格式的包混合在一起就需要加一个判断,看到有这种写法的:
pcapfile = open('xxx.pcapng', 'rb')
try:
pcaps = dpkt.pcap.Reader(pcapfile)
except Exception as e:
pcaps = dpk
原创
2020-12-27 15:56:10 ·
2607 阅读 ·
1 评论